Can You Drink Alcohol While Taking Antidepressants вђ World Of Medic This can impair your ability to drive or do other tasks that require focus and attention. you may become sedated or feel drowsy. a few antidepressants cause sedation and drowsiness, and so does alcohol. when taken together, the combined effect can be intensified. don't stop taking an antidepressant or other medication just so that you can drink. A few antidepressants cause sedation and drowsiness, as does alcohol. when taken together, the combined effect can be intensified. some people who are depressed have trouble sleeping. while drinking alcohol may help you fall asleep more quickly, people tend to wake up more in the middle of the night and get a less quality sleep.
